Locating the Right Fit: Size and Style Guidance

How can healthcare professionals guarantee they select the right scrubs for their needs? This process starts by reviewing sizing charts carefully, as measurements can differ significantly across brands. Recording exact body measurements—such as chest, waist, hips, and inseam—guarantees a more comfortable and proper fit. Professionals should also consider the cut of the scrubs, as styles range from fitted to relaxed, impacting comfort during long shifts.

Additionally, stretch and breathability in fabric are key factors for comfort and movement. Opting for scrubs with adjustable features, such as drawstrings or elastic waistbands, allows for customization. Personal color and design choices can impact workplace morale; lively colors and designs tend to create a more positive work environment.

In the end, testing different sizes and styles in-store or taking advantage of online fit guides can help in making informed choices. By paying attention to these important elements, clinical staff can find scrubs that not only fit well but also meet their functional and aesthetic needs.

Essential Laundry Care Tips

Preserving the lifespan of medical scrubs demands close attention to care guidelines. To protect the material and color, washing scrubs in cold water is recommended, since hot water may cause shrinkage and fading. Using a mild detergent guarantees that the fibers remain intact while effectively cleaning the garments. Avoid bleach, as it can weaken the fabric and alter colors. Regarding drying, air drying is the ideal choice; that said, if a dryer is necessary, using a low heat setting is advised to prevent harm. Additionally, scrubs should be washed separately from other clothing to avoid lint transfer. Observing these care instructions will contribute to extending the longevity of medical scrubs, guaranteeing they continue to be comfortable and effective for healthcare workers.

Techniques for Removing Stains

Effective stain removal is important for protecting the condition and lifespan of medical scrubs. Healthcare professionals frequently encounter various stains, from blood to ink, which necessitate timely treatment. To address these stains, pre-treating is advisable; placing a stain remover onto the impacted area can boost effectiveness. For blood stains, cool water is necessary, as heated water risks locking in the stain. For grease or oil-based stains, a blend of dish detergent and water can be helpful. After pre-treatment, garments should be cleaned in line with the manufacturer's directions. Regularly checking for any remaining stains before drying is critical, as heat can set stains permanently. By using these methods, the quality and presentation of medical scrubs can be upheld with continued use.
